几年前,当 Halfbrick Studios 的 CEO Shainiel Deo 把 Fruit Ninja (水果忍者)的第一版作品拿到他的妻子身边的时候,他惊讶地发现自己那平时异常“憎恨”电子游戏的妻子居然对这款 Slice-em-up 形式的休闲小游戏爱不释手。

“我专注于观察她的脸庞。当我看到她的注意力前所未有地集中在屏幕上,脸上尽是较真的神情的时候,我就知道,这款游戏有戏了。”

上周六,Shainiel Deo 受国内一些合作伙伴的邀请首次来华,参加了在上海举办的全球互动娱乐专家讲坛,跟在座的数百名业内人士以及 Fruit Ninja 的玩家交流了这款已经在全球范围内一举创造超过 2000 万次跨平台付费下载量的手机游戏背后的故事。

Halfbrick Friday——创意孵化器

Halfbrick Studios 是位于澳大利亚布里斯班的一个小型游戏工作室,由 Shainiel Deo 在2001年建立。工作室的总共 45 名员工组成了5个工作团队,分别负责不同游戏在不同平台的开发工作。

在 Halfbrick Studios 内部,一直有一个工作传统,Shainiel Deo 称之为 Halfbrick Friday,类似于 Google 内部著名的“20%时间”。每逢周五,工程师们便会放下手头的工作,聚集在一起边喝咖啡边讨论自己在近一周时间里萌生的游戏创意点子。有些时候员工们的创意铺天盖地地涌现,而工作室又没有足够的资源将它们一一实现。

于是,工作室内部便会进行表决。一旦一个制作新游戏的点子得到了2-5 名员工的支持,那么这 2-5 名员工便有权利在接下来的 4-5 周时间之内将创意制作成游戏雏形。最后,一旦该游戏雏形在全体投票环节得到了广泛的认可,那么几周之后,你就可能会在 App Store 或是 Android Market 上看到它最终版本的身影了。

公司赖以成名的作品 Fruit Ninja 的创意,则也是源于一名游戏设计师在看某销售刀具的电视购物节目时,看到水果被抛到空中由刀具劈开,而在 Halfbrick Friday 上发起的倡议。换句话说,如果当时 Fruit Ninja 的创意没有得到公司内部 2-5 名员工的支持从而得以开发 Demo 版本,恐怕就只能胎死腹中了吧。

其实不光是 Fruit Ninja,工作室的其它知名作品 Jetpack Joyride(前段时间一举冲上过美国区 App Store 付费应用榜单前 5 位)、Monster Dash 等也都是得到了 Halfbrick Friday 机制的孵化。这些小型游戏工作室内部简单灵活的决策程序所具备的优点显而易见。

谈到孕育了各种游戏创意的 Halfbrick Friday,Shainiel Deo 说他信奉的人生哲学之一就是 Ideas come from everywhere(灵感无处不在)。

“为什么忍者要讨厌水果?”

包括我在内,相信许多 Fruit Ninja 的玩家在刚上手时都会在心里这样嘀咕一句。而 Shainiel Deo 表示,正是这样的困惑才会使刚听到这个古怪游戏名字的玩家有了进入游戏一探究竟的念头。

众所周知,在一款应用被推入市场销售的初期,它的图标(icon)设计和游戏名称(title)设计无疑是相当重要的。Rovio 内部的头号人物、被称为 Mighty Eagle 的 Peter Vesterbacka 曾经透露,当 Rovio 内部在设计 Angry Birds 的图标的时候,他们发现在 App Store 付费应用榜单的前几十位中,很少有应用的图标选择了红色作为主要颜色。这一点使他们决定将那只红色的小鸟放上图标,成为整个游戏的主角。

回到 Fruit Ninja 本身,在职场压力和家庭压力越来越大的都市社会里,手机上的那一个个水果仿佛就成了人们泄愤的工具。随着一个个饱满的水果被畅快地切开,汁水瞬间溅满整个屏幕,人们心里积聚已久的郁闷、挫折感仿佛得到了烟消云散的缓解,而渴望已久的快感、成就感也仿佛获得了淋漓尽致的释放。你可以把水果想象成任何 pissed you off 的人,而你就是那个手持利刃的水果终结者。这也就难怪你为什么每天都会在上海地铁的车厢里看到众多白领们在上班和下班的路上为了切出高分周而复始、捶胸顿足、乐此不疲了。

Fruit Ninja 的未来

在10月即将发布的 iOS 5中,Apple 对于手势操控(Finger Gestures)又有了一些新的定义。借鉴自 Android 的相关设计,在 iOS 5 中,当用户将手指从设备屏幕上方向下滑动时,会立刻调出“通知中心”(Notification Center)。正是由于这一点,许多将 iOS 版本升级为 iOS 5 Beta 的开发者均反应,当他们在 Fruit Ninja 中滑动屏幕进行游戏时,会时不时地误触发“通知中心”。

针对这一问题,我问了 Shainiel Deo 有没有什么解决方案,得到的答案是正面积极的。Shainiel Deo 告诉我,现在最新的解决方案将会是一个“两步机制”(2-step process)。换句话说,iOS 5正式版发布之后,如果用户在运行 Fruit Njnja 时需要刻意启动“通知中心”,则需要进行两个具体步骤的操作,而不只是将手指从屏幕顶端向下滑动那么简单了。

另外,我还问了 Shainiel Deo 有没有想过借鉴 Angry Birds 的成功经验,将 Fruit Ninja 作为一个品牌进行后续打造的想法。Shainiel Deo 回答说,他们的确正在开发 3 个新版本的 Fruit Ninja 游戏,希望这些新版本的游戏也能取得成功。

最后的话

好吧,你不得不承认:5年之前,你可能会对着一款 PC 单机游戏连续不停、天昏地暗地玩上 12 个小时,但到了今天,你可能更喜欢花 12 分钟在等车的时候掏出移动设备玩上一轮诸如 Fruit Ninja 的小游戏了。

Shainiel Deo 在现场给大家展示了 Fruit Ninja 中每一个水果被切开的慢放至 10% 速度的动画,每一个“切开”动作的物理反馈细节都是如此地逼真,这些让我们乐此不疲的小游戏,背后并不简单。

转载于:https://www.cnblogs.com/junny253/archive/2011/11/17/2253254.html

《水果忍者》背后的故事 转自codeios WilsonWu相关推荐

  1. 《水果忍者》背后的故事

    几年前,当 Halfbrick Studios 的 CEO Shainiel Deo 把 Friut Ninja (水果忍者)的第一版作品拿到他的妻子身边的时候,他惊讶地发现自己那平时异常" ...

  2. 2013年10月i--q手机下载游戏水果忍者

    据悉,草案新增和修改的条目共68条,可概括为12个方面的增加.8个方面的完善.其中,进一步强化法律责任,加大对违法行为的惩处力度成为本次修改的一个重点.具体体现在法条中,则有引入"黑名单&q ...

  3. 那些开源项目和编程语言背后的故事

    关注.星标公众号,不错过精彩内容 整理:黄工 素材来源:opensource.com 你有没有想过自己最喜欢的开源项目或编程语言的名称来自何处?有着怎样的起源和含义?开源社区汇总了一些人们最常使用的项 ...

  4. 做android版水果忍者有感

    做android版水果忍者有感 大三下学期选了门专选叫动漫和网络游戏原理,课程设计我们小组选了做android版的水果忍者.有些小组是用之前做过的游戏改进一下来提交,但我不想这样,一来是对之前的作品不 ...

  5. 图像处理经典图片Lena背后的故事

    点击上方"小白学视觉",选择加"星标"或"置顶" 重磅干货,第一时间送达本文转自|新机器视觉 在数字图像处理中,Lena(Lenna)是一张 ...

  6. HTML5背后的故事

    乍一看,你可能觉得HTML5是网页编写语言HTML的第5个版本.但实际上,这背后的故事可乱得多. HTML5是一个叛逆.它是由一群自由思想者组成的团队设计出来的,这个团队的成员并不负责制定官方HTML ...

  7. [unity3d]水果忍者-界面搭建

    今天开始用Unity3D做一下水果忍者的游戏,Keep study very day! 效果图: 实现步骤: 1.贴图的创建 , 这里的Pixel Inset中X,Y,Width,Height是贴图的 ...

  8. android 新闻编辑,超机访问:ZOL手机新闻编辑背后的故事

    在上周超机访问中,我们为大家介绍了手机频道评测刘宇航和手机的故事.通过上期节目,我们对这位评测编辑以及他的工作.使用手机的偏好有了一个全面的了解.本期节目我们再次请到了中关村在线的编辑,来讲讲他和手机 ...

  9. 我眼中的计算机,我眼中的计算机-计算机开机背后的故事

    我眼中的计算机-计算机开机背后的故事 (20页) 本资源提供全文预览,点击全文预览即可全文预览,如果喜欢文档就下载吧,查找使用更方便哦! 14.90 积分 ? 我们每天使用计算机必 须要做的第一件事就 ...

最新文章

  1. python版本选择-【小白学python】之一:版本选择
  2. MapReduce实现共同朋友问题
  3. Oracle定时器调用存储过程
  4. 数据库表连接总结:等值连接, 自然连接,左外连接,右外连接,内连接,全外连接;
  5. CPU有个禁区,内核权限也无法进入!
  6. OneAPM Cloud Test——系统性能监控神器 1
  7. 你愿意一辈子当一个打工的吗
  8. Java集合框架使用总结
  9. popwin.js 弹出小窗口,图片预览;
  10. Python入门--else语句
  11. 中介者模式(Mediator) 笔记
  12. 第10章 vim程序编辑器
  13. 使用HTML制作网页
  14. openssl生成ras证书
  15. Oracle_登录数据库系统
  16. pytest自动化测试
  17. java期末知识点总结_java期末复习
  18. 吞吐量和 IOPS 及测试工具 FIO 使用
  19. 视频翻译成文字的软件有哪些?推荐几个软件给你
  20. 手拿菜刀砍电线,一路火花带闪电,神经病人思维广,弱智孩子欢乐多!

热门文章

  1. ##正则表达式常见类的使用
  2. Xcode iOS 的模拟器 Simulator 模拟网络环境
  3. 雨量小能手压电式雨量监测站不堵不站维护简单
  4. 【ES6 教程】第一章 新的ES6语法04—如何设置函数参数的默认值
  5. 互联网首发 | 闲鱼程序员公开多年 Flutter 实践经验
  6. 小胶质细胞仅仅是神经系统内的“配角”?
  7. 大数据处理算法一:BitMap算法
  8. 标准库:DB 数据库
  9. 拯救007 迪杰斯特拉最短路解决
  10. bresenham直线画法